What are some great stand - alone adult fiction books?
2 answers
2024-12-09 09:21
Another one is 'To Kill a Mockingbird' by Harper Lee. This novel tackles issues of racism and injustice in a small Southern town. It's a powerful story told through the eyes of a young girl, Scout Finch, and her father, Atticus, who defends a black man wrongly accused of a crime.

What are some great historical fiction stand alone books?
2 answers
2024-11-19 04:13
One great historical fiction stand - alone book is 'The Pillars of the Earth' by Ken Follett. It's set in 12th - century England and vividly depicts the building of a cathedral. Another is 'Wolf Hall' by Hilary Mantel, which focuses on the life of Thomas Cromwell in the Tudor court. And 'All the Light We Cannot See' by Anthony Doerr is also excellent, set during World War II, following the lives of a blind French girl and a German boy.
